Select Page

El conocimiento es como el fuego, que primero debe ser encendido por algún agente externo, pero que después se propaga por sí solo.

Ben Jonson

Bienvenidos

Esta web esta dedicada a aquellos que hacen del copy paste una forma de vida…

Obtener tamaño de array en jstl

<%@taglib uri="http://java.sun.com/jsp/jstl/core" prefix="c" %> <%@taglib uri="http://java.sun.com/jsp/jstl/fmt" prefix="fmt" %> <%@ taglib uri="http://java.sun.com/jsp/jstl/functions"...

Añadir un portlet al panel de control

Puede darse el caso que nos interese añadir un portlet como elemento del control-panel de liferay, esto sera posible mediante parametro de configuracion: <!-- Configuraciín en liferay-portlet --> <icon>/icon.png</icon>...

Script Drop All tables sqlDeveloper

Si queremos eliminar todas las tablas de una base de datos oracle desde sqldeveloper debemos ser unos autenticos copiadores. Lo primero sera ejecutar una select que nos devuelva todas las tablas preparadas para ser borradas, copiaremos el resultado de dicha select lo...

Limpiar contenido de un input type=”file”

Los inputs de tipo file en muchas ocasiones tienen un tratamiento distinto al resto de los inputs, por ejemplo, son no editables y no se puede cambiar su valor usando javascript. Para poder borrar el valor de un campo de tipo input, remplazaremos el campo por una...

Peticciones https desde java

Podemos encontrarnos problemas al realizar peticciones https desde nuestro codigo java, por ejemplo para realizar peticciones para consultar rss RssFeed rssFeed = rssList.get(0); URL url = new URL(rssFeed.getUrl()); SyndFeedInput input = new SyndFeedInput(); SyndFeed...

Tomcat en modo debug

Una gran utilidad para poder depurar nuestro codigo tanto en local como en remoto es poner el servidor de aplicaciones en modo debug, en este post veremos varias opciones para distintos entornos.

Convertir HTML a PDF

En ocasiones nos puede ser util poder convertir un html a PDF, para ellos utilizaremos dos librerias: – core-renderer.jar – itext-paulo-155.jar Pincha aqui para descargar las librerias El codigo es el siguiente: import...

Fondo 100%

Siempre es un problema poner una imagen de fondo al 100%, aqui pongo alguna solucción que puede resultar interesante. Opcion 1 CSS normales HTML <div id="bg"> <img src="images/bg.jpg" alt=""> </div> CSS #bg { position:...

Bordes redondeados

Siempre que queremos poner bordes redondeados pensamos “Donde habia visto yo como se ponia esto…?“, bueno aqui ponemos una pequeña soluccion para cuando no disponemos de css3 y queremos dar este efecto a nuestros bloques. /* añade estilos en linea de...

Hibernate InvalidMappingException

Trabajando con Hibernate, en una relación 1-n bidireccional, obtuve un error en un mapeo SLF4J: Defaulting to no-operation (NOP) logger implementationSLF4J: See http://www.slf4j.org/codes.html#StaticLoggerBinder for further details.Initial SessionFactory creation...

Excepción en Hibernate

Esta excepción a mí me ocurrió cuando estaba intentando actualizar un registro de cuyo id no tenemos existencia en la base de datos, porque acababa de ser borrado. org.hibernate.StaleStateException: Batch update returned unexpected row count from update [0]; actual...

Hacer un redirect con struts

Problema: He creado un post, y el forward me llevó al listado de post, sin embargo, como la url es /crearActionPost.do  , si le doy a refrescar me volverá a crear el mismo post.  Quiero que me cambie la url, para que aunque refresquen, sea imposible volver a...

html:href .vs. a href

Problema:  Queremos llamar desde una jsp a un action de struts.Posibilidades:  Usar una etiqueta “a” de html o usar una etiqueta “Conclusión:  Mejor usar la de Struts, puesto que relativiza y puedes llamar a un action sin .do y sin...

Hibernate desde 0 usando Struts 1.3.10

Hoy me topé con la necesidad de integrar Hibernate junto con Struts, y aquí os dejo unos pasos y unos buenos tutoriales 1.-Me bajé el zip con el contenido de hibernate.  https://sourceforge.net/projects/hibernate/?source=dlp  y en el eclipse, en la carpeta...

Poder ver ficheros ocultos en el mac

Cuando quiero ver carpetas ocultas o ficheros ocultos, por ejemplo, lo necesitaba para ver ficheros .svn de un determinado proyecto. En el mac es necesario ejecutar por consola lo siguiente: miMAC:~ miusuario$ defaults write com.apple.finder AppleShowAllFiles TRUE...